CP-610431
- CAS No.: 591778-83-5
- Formula:C30H37N3O2
- Molecular Weight:471.63
IUPAC Name: (R)-1'-(anthracene-9-carbonyl)-N,N-diethyl-[1,4'-bipiperidine]-3-carboxamide
InChIKey: TXUIRLUAKARNPD-XMMPIXPASA-N
SMILES: O=C([C@H]1CN(C2CCN(C(C3=C4C=CC=CC4=CC5=CC=CC=C35)=O)CC2)CCC1)N(CC)CC
Biological Activity: CP-610431 is a reversible, ATP-uncompetitive, isozyme-nonselective acetyl-CoA carboxylase (ACC) inhibitor. CP-610431 inhibits ACC1 and ACC2 with IC50s of ~50 nM. CP-610431 can be used for the research of metabolic syndrome[1].
